Just days after his associate Bankroll Fresh was gunned down, rapper 2 Chainz is having to address a rumor that he was robbed in Atlanta. The hip-hop star posted a video on Instagram blasting media personality Big Tigger, who apparently the rapper believed was responsible for sharing the story.

Alongside the caption, "No time for the rumors my album goin crazy #COLLEGROVE#longlivebank" 2 Chainz posted a video addressing the situation.

“Yo I just tried to called Big Tigger. Somebody @ Big Tigger and tell him to call my phone. Spreading rumors is a no no. You know we don’t f*ck with them rumors. Ain’t nobody robbed, touched me, done nothing. I’m in New York doing radio. RIP Bank.”

The two allegedly finally connected and Tigger explained that he wasn't spreading the story. 2 Chainz apologized and things seem to have been smoothed over.

"My bad , playaz fuc up," captioned the rapper in a second IG post. 

As mentioned, this past weekend 28-year-old rapper Bankroll Fresh, born Trentavious White, was shot while inside an Atlanta recording studio. Police says over 50 shell casings were found both inside and outside the facility. 2 Chainz was a close associate and mentor to the rapper.
